A leading transportation company in Swindon is seeking a skilled individual to provide technical support to its Maintenance Engineering team. The role involves ensuring compliance with safety procedures, managing specifications, and guiding inspections.

Ideal candidates will have knowledge of electrification processes and the ability to coach others effectively. With an annual salary of £31,924, this position is suited for those committed to building a safer, efficient railway infrastructure.
